摘要
10 Gbit/s, 6000 km NRZ signal transmission is demonstrated using 119 erbium-doped fibre amplifiers spaced at 50 km intervals. The optical pulse reshaping technique efficiently reduces the power penalty to less than 4-0 dB. The acheived bit-rate-transmission-distance product of 60 Tbits. km is the best value yet reported.
